Advantages of Upgrading to a Composite Door

Before diving into the different aspects of upgrading, let's very first check out the numerous advantages that composite doors use over conventional wood or PVC doors.

BenefitsDescription
DurabilityComposite doors are resistant to warping, splitting, and fading, guaranteeing they preserve their appearance and performance gradually.
Energy EfficiencyBoosted insulation homes help keep homes warm in winter and cool in summer, eventually saving on energy expenses.
SecurityComposite doors feature robust materials and advanced locking mechanisms, offering much better security compared to conventional doors.
Aesthetic AppealReadily available in a broad variety of styles, colors, and surfaces, composite doors can quickly match any architectural design while improving curb appeal.
Low MaintenanceUnlike wood doors that require routine painting or staining, composite doors are easy to preserve, requiring just periodic cleaning with soap and water.

Factors to Upgrade Your Composite Door

Upgrading your composite door can bring various advantages, from improved security to enhanced aesthetic appeal. Here are some compelling reasons one might think about an upgrade:

1. Boosted Security Features

Modern composite doors come equipped with sophisticated locking mechanisms, making them more secure than older designs. Updating can include features such as multi-point locking systems, which ensure a more secure fit and deter prospective trespassers.

2. Improved Energy Efficiency

Older composite doors may not offer the exact same level of insulation as more recent models. Updating to  website -day composite door can considerably improve your home's energy effectiveness, leading to lower cooling and heating expenses.

3. Aesthetic Improvements

If your existing door has become outdated or doesn't match your home's style, an upgrade can assist. New composite doors are offered in various designs, colors, and finishes, permitting house owners to choose a design that complements their property completely.

4. Increased Property Value

A stylish, secure, and energy-efficient door can improve your home's overall worth. Prospective buyers typically appreciate the advantages of a contemporary composite door, making it a worthwhile financial investment.

5. Very little Maintenance

While older composite doors may need occasional refinishing, brand-new advancements in products and style suggest modern-day composite doors require minimal maintenance. This ease of maintenance can conserve house owners money and time.

Secret Features to Look for When Upgrading Your Composite Door

When considering an upgrade, it's important to look for particular functions that ensure you're getting the finest item for your requirements.

FunctionDescription
Product QualitySearch for premium materials such as fiberglass or enhanced plastic.
InsulationLook for energy-efficient glass and insulation products that meet the most recent requirements.
Security RatingsMake sure the door satisfies or exceeds the British Standard for security (BS3621).
Design OptionsPick from different colors, textures, and panel styles to fit your home's aesthetic appeals.
WarrantyA strong guarantee suggests a manufacturer's confidence in their product quality.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. How long does a composite door last?

Composite doors are designed to last substantially longer than conventional wood doors, normally between 30 to 50 years, depending upon the quality of products and maintenance.

2. Are composite doors energy-efficient?

Yes, composite doors are renowned for their energy performance. They typically have exceptional insulation homes that help keep homes at a comfy temperature level.

3. Can I tailor my composite door?

Definitely! Many manufacturers provide a wide variety of customizations, including color, style, and hardware options, permitting you to develop a door that matches your home perfectly.

4. Are composite doors safe?

Yes, composite doors are normally extremely secure. Lots of included multi-point locking systems and are made from sturdy materials, making them highly resistant to break-in.

5. How do I preserve my composite door?

Maintaining a composite door is straightforward. Routine cleaning with a mild detergent and water, in addition to regular examine hinges and locks, ensures longevity.
